Is cycling the same as using the hydraulics for a long time until the air is cleared?
Yea. Cycling the controls runs fluid through the system and back to the reservoir.
Whens the last time you did a hydraulic service? Did you recently work your tractor really hard? Some hydraulic oil can get cooked but it take a lot to do that. There should be an air vent on your system that is designed to release built up air. Take a picture of the oil and post it. If it’s milky or that’s not good and there could be water and or algae in it.
If it’s a little cloudy there could be air in there and air creates cavitation which is the jumpiness you’re describing. Get some pictures of the hydro oil if you can
